Job Description

We are seeking a hands-on, operationally focused Controller to serve as a key financial leader within a growing manufacturing organization. This role is a unique blend of Plant Controller and Corporate Controller responsibilities — ideal for someone who enjoys being deeply connected to operations while also driving high-level financial reporting, forecasting, and business strategy. The Controller will partner closely with plant leadership, executive management, and cross-functional teams to improve profitability, strengthen reporting, and support strategic decision-making across the organization. This individual must be equally comfortable on the manufacturing floor analyzing operational drivers as they are in the boardroom presenting financial results and recommendations.
